About Inmaculada Sánchez‐Machín
Inmaculada Sánchez‐Machín is a scholar working on Immunology and Allergy, Dermatology and Physiology, having authored 61 papers that have together received 519 indexed citations. Recurring topics across this work include Allergic Rhinitis and Sensitization (34 papers), Food Allergy and Anaphylaxis Research (23 papers) and Asthma and respiratory diseases (20 papers). The work is most often cited by research in Immunology and Allergy (367 citations), Dermatology (214 citations) and Physiology (231 citations). Inmaculada Sánchez‐Machín has collaborated with scholars based in Spain, Sweden and Canada. Frequent co-authors include Paloma Poza‐Guedes, Ruperto González‐Pérez, Víctor Matheu, Fernando Pineda, Víctor Iraola, Pablo Rodríguez del Río, Andrés Franco, Peter Eberle, J. Borja and Pascal Demoly.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and International Journal of Molecular Sciences.
